Background and Context
San Francisco's decision to establish this hub reflects the city's acknowledgment of the growing need for accessible and effective mental health services. The Tenderloin, with its high concentration of residents struggling with homelessness, substance abuse, and mental illness, was identified as a critical location for such a facility. By situating the hub in this area, the city aims to reach those who are most in need, providing them with a lifeline of support and resources.

Services and Features
The 24/7 behavioral health hub offers a wide range of services, including crisis intervention, counseling, medication management, and social support. Some of the key features of the hub include:
- Round-the-clock access to trained mental health professionals
- State-of-the-art medical facilities and equipment
- Individual and group therapy sessions
- Peer support groups and community outreach programs
- Collaboration with local healthcare providers and social services
By providing these comprehensive services, the hub aims to address the complex and interconnected issues surrounding mental health, offering patients a supportive environment in which to heal and grow.
